PLOT:John Adams (William Daniels) is an arrogant and obnoxious Patriot who is fighting Congress for American Independence with his partners in the Declaration Committee, Benjamin Franklin (Howard Da Silva) and Thomas Jefferson (Ken Howard) as the Revolution is occurring, but Jefferson's personal problems, tolerance of the Declaration's rules, and trying to get the whole thing accepted is a trouble. It's a good subject to make a movie on-but a musical? It's executed decently considering the fact that it's based off a '69 musical.
ACTING:Very good acting. The shiners are Daniels and Da Silva. They have friend chemistry and spark interest in the characters.
SCORE:The score is composed very well and is very patriotic. The soundtrack has its ups and downs. Some songs where the singers can't sing worth a crap are "Yours Yours Yours" and "The Lees of Virginia". Some beautiful songs are "Momma Look Sharp" and "Molasses to Rum". Some just plain silly songs are "The Egg" and "He Plays the Violin". The soundtrack overall is not too bad considering it's a historical musical.
OTHER CONTENT:Some may argue that the historical accuracy isn't too good, but I say that it's pretty well researched, for we have learned this stuff in history class this past week. I will admit, it left out a few things. It's pretty accurate in basics though. Though this movie is so stupid it's funny and cheesy to the extreme, it's supposed to be. It's a BROADWAY COMEDY MUSICAL! It's cheesy in a way that it's campy, but not well enough executed to be considered good. Even in some scenes, it helps you feel the dread of this time's war and loss.
OVERALL, an ok musical with a decently executed plot, great acting, patriotic score and not too bad of a soundtrack, pretty good historic accuracy, a thin layer of campiness, and actual feeling.
